What is the ground clearance of the Buick Regal?

The ground clearance of the 2020 Buick Regal is 152 millimeters. The ground clearance of the 2020 Buick Regal refers to the distance between the lowest point (excluding the wheels) and the supporting plane, which indicates the vehicle's ability to pass over obstacles such as rocks and tree stumps without collision. A higher ground clearance for the 2020 Buick Regal improves off-road capability, but if the ground clearance is too high, the stability at high speeds may decrease. As one of Buick's most successful strategic models, the Regal has gained widespread popularity among users due to its trendy, dynamic, and tech-savvy product image and comprehensive technical capabilities. The 2020 Buick Regal measures 4913 millimeters in length, 1863 millimeters in width, and 1462 millimeters in height, with a wheelbase of 2829 millimeters. Generally, the ground clearance of sedans ranges between 110 millimeters and 150 millimeters, while SUVs have a ground clearance between 200 millimeters and 250 millimeters. However, the ground clearance of the 2020 Buick Regal is not static; it also depends on the load condition. Therefore, changes in ground clearance should be considered based on the load variations of the 2020 Buick Regal. When selecting a vehicle, ground clearance can be one of the reference factors. The choice should depend on the vehicle's intended use and the road conditions. For urban areas with well-paved roads, a vehicle with lower ground clearance can enhance stability and comfort. For those frequently traveling to remote areas or driving on rough terrain, a vehicle with higher ground clearance is advisable to improve off-road performance and avoid damage to the chassis.

I've driven the Buick Regal quite a few times, and I remember its ground clearance fluctuates around 140mm to 150mm, depending on the model year and configuration. Simply put, it's the distance between the car body and the ground. The Buick Regal is positioned as a family sedan, so its design isn't particularly high, but it's better than some small sports cars. When driving on bumpy roads, this height is just right to avoid scraping the undercarriage or damaging the chassis, especially on urban speed bumps and gravel roads—it feels very stable. However, if you're driving on muddy rural roads, you'll need to be more cautious since it's not an SUV with high ground clearance. I recommend regularly checking tire pressure because if it's too low, it can affect the ground clearance and overall drivability. Maintenance is straightforward—just clean any debris from the undercarriage during car washes to keep it tidy, which helps prolong the suspension's lifespan. Overall, this height is suitable for most road conditions, making it both practical and worry-free.

Speaking of the Buick Regal's ground clearance, I feel it's generally around 145mm, which is quite standard for a regular sedan. From a driving perspective, it sits relatively low, offering agile handling but some body roll during cornering. I've tried the GS version, which has a stronger sporty feel but an even lower height. For modifications, you could install an air suspension to raise it a bit, making it better suited for steep slopes or snowy roads. In practical driving, this height is sufficient for daily commutes, providing stability and comfort on highways. However, you'll need to slow down when encountering waterlogged roads or rural paths to avoid splashing water or scraping against bumps. Compared to SUVs, it's certainly lower, but it's more fuel-efficient and quieter, making it a cost-effective choice for families. Don't forget that tire wear can also affect the height, so regular tread checks can prevent minor issues.

What is the engine model of the Honda Spirior?

LFA11 is the engine model used in the Honda Spirior, with a maximum horsepower of 146 hp, a maximum power of 107 KW, a maximum power speed of 6200 rpm, and a peak torque of 175 N.m. The engine of the Honda Spirior is produced in the Wuhan Economic and Technological Development Zone. The engine of the Honda Spirior can be maintained daily using the following methods: Use lubricating oil of the appropriate quality grade. For gasoline engines, SD--SF grade gasoline engine oil should be selected based on the additional devices of the intake and exhaust systems and usage conditions; for diesel engines, CB--CD grade diesel engine oil should be selected according to the mechanical load, and the selection standard should not be lower than the requirements specified by the manufacturer. Regularly change the oil and filter. The quality of any grade of lubricating oil will change during use. After a certain mileage, the performance deteriorates, which can cause various problems for the engine. To avoid malfunctions, the oil should be changed regularly according to usage conditions, and the oil level should be kept moderate. When the oil passes through the fine holes of the filter, solid particles and viscous substances in the oil accumulate in the filter. If the filter is blocked and the oil cannot pass through the filter element, the filter element may burst or the safety valve may open, allowing the oil to pass through the bypass valve and bring dirt back to the lubrication area, accelerating engine wear and increasing internal contamination. Regularly clean the crankcase. During engine operation, high-pressure unburned gas, acid, moisture, sulfur, and nitrogen oxides from the combustion chamber enter the crankcase through the gap between the piston rings and the cylinder wall, mixing with metal powder generated by part wear to form sludge. When the amount is small, it remains suspended in the oil; when the amount is large, it precipitates from the oil, blocking the filter and oil holes, making engine lubrication difficult and causing wear. Regularly use a radiator cleaner to clean the radiator. Removing rust and scale not only ensures the normal operation of the engine but also extends the overall lifespan of the radiator and the engine.

How often should the transmission fluid be changed for the Fit?

According to the Fit car manual, the transmission fluid should be changed every two years or every 40,000 kilometers. Transmission fluid is a lubricant used to keep the transmission system clean, ensuring the transmission operates normally and extending the lifespan of the transmission components. Long-term high-speed operation causes wear on the transmission gears and generates a large amount of metal particles and other impurities. Failing to change the fluid in time can lead to abnormal wear and noise in the transmission gears, and even cause transmission failure or complete breakdown. Below are some key points to note when changing automatic transmission fluid: 1. It is crucial to use the original transmission fluid specified for your vehicle model. Only the original transmission fluid can meet the requirements of the transmission. Other brands, low-quality, or counterfeit transmission fluids can cause abnormal wear and severe damage to the transmission over time. 2. Have the transmission fluid changed at a professional transmission service center to avoid indirect transmission issues caused by unprofessional or improper technical operations.

Which country does Geely belong to?

Geely is a Chinese automotive brand headquartered in Hangzhou, Zhejiang, China. In 1996, Geely Group Co., Ltd. was established, marking the beginning of its large-scale development. Geely Auto's vehicle lineup includes models such as the Xingyue L, Xingyue S, Xingrui, Emgrand series, Binyue, Binrui, Haoyue, ICON, Boyue series, Jiayu, Borui, and Vision series. The Geely logo was originally inspired by the concept of six-pack abs. The emblem consists of six gemstones: blue gemstones represent the azure sky, black gemstones symbolize the vast earth, and the combination of dual-colored gemstones signifies Geely's ambition to traverse between heaven and earth, reaching every corner of the world. Key milestones in Geely's development include: 1997 – Geely entered the automotive industry. 1998 – The first Geely vehicle rolled off the production line in Linhai City, Zhejiang Province. 2003 – The first batch of Geely sedans was exported overseas, achieving a "zero breakthrough" in car exports. 2010 – Geely Auto acquired Volvo. 2015 – Geely's 1.8TD engine was awarded the "China Heart" Top 10 Engines of 2015.

What brand of tires does the Buick Verano use?

The Buick Verano is equipped with Continental EFFICIENTGRIP PremiumContact series tires with the specification 205/55-R16. Below is an introduction to the tires: 1. The main functions of tires include dry grip, hydroplaning resistance, providing comfort, reducing driving noise, impact resistance, wet grip, load capacity, handling performance, average wear, and mileage. 2. The cross-sectional structure of a tire can generally be divided into four parts: tread, shoulder, sidewall, and bead. Each part has its own function. The tread mainly contacts the ground, the shoulder and sidewall provide support, and the bead contacts the wheel rim to provide sealing.

What is the introduction of the Hongqi brand?

For FAW people, Hongqi represents not only a brand but also a strong sense of responsibility and a historical mission. In 1958, the 'Hongqi' brand car was born. Since then, Hongqi has become the official vehicle for state leaders and major national events. In the 1960s and 1970s, Hongqi cars were a banner of China's automotive industry.
